Smoky Baked Beans
Ingredients
  • 2 cups dry navy beans, soaked overnight
  • 1/2 pound uncooked bacon strips
  • 1 medium onion, diced
  • 1/2 cup ketchup
  • 3 tablespoons molasses
  • 1/4 cup brown sugar
  • 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
  • 2 teaspoons sal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 1/4 teaspoon dry mustard
Instructions
1
Transfer the soaked navy beans along with their soaking water to a saucepan.
2
Heat it up until it reaches a rolling boil. Then, decrease the heat and let it simmer for about 1 to 2 hours, or until the beans are almost tender.
3
Remove from heat and set aside, reserving the cooking liquid that was left over.
4
Preheat your oven to 325 degrees Fahrenheit (165 degrees Celsius).
5
Layer half of the navy beans in the bottom of a 2-quart casserole dish. Place half of the bacon strips on top of the beans, followed by half of the onions.
6
Repeat this layering process one more time to create a stacked effect.
7
In a large saucepan, combine ketchup, molasses, brown sugar, Worcestershire sauce, salt, pepper, and dry mustard over medium heat. Bring the mixture to a boil.
8
Pour this sauce over the navy beans, adding just enough of the reserved cooking liquid to cover them completely. Cover the casserole dish with a lid or aluminum foil.
9
Bake in the preheated oven for 1 and a half hours. Remove the lid and continue to cook, checking every half hour or so until the beans are soft and tender, which may take an additional 1 and a half to 2 and a half hours.
10
Serve the dish hot, straight from the oven.
